About Thom Vreven

Thom Vreven is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Materials Chemistry,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and Inorganic Chemistry, having authored 76 papers that have together received 7.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(22 papers), Protein Structure and Dynamics (19 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(17 papers), Photochemistry and Electron Transfer Studies (12 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(10 papers), Photoreceptor and optogenetics research (10 papers), Computational Drug Discovery Methods (9 papers) and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(1.1k cit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(1.9k citations), Molecular Biology (3.9k citations), Inorganic Chemistry (722 citations) and Computational Theory and Mathematics (704 citations). Thom Vreven has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Keiji Morokuma, Zhiping Weng, Michael J. Frisch, Howook Hwang, Brian G. Pierce, H. Bernhard Schlegel, Kevin Wiehe, Bong‐Hyun Kim, Michael A. Robb and Massimo Olivucci. Their work appears in journals such as Proteins Structure Function and Bioinformatics, Journal of the American Chemical Society, Journal of Chemical Theory and Computation, The Journal of Chemical Physics and Bioinformatics.
